#012d6d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#012d6d is composed of 0.4% red, 17.6%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.1% cyan, 58.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 215.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 21.6%. #012d6d color hex could be obtained by blending #025ada with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#012d6d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00050c is the darkest color, while #f7faff is the lightest one.

Tones of #012d6d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#34363a is the less saturated color, while #012d6d is the most saturated one.
